Causes of Cats Eye Gunk

There are several reasons why your cat may have eye gunk. One common cause is allergies, which can lead to excessive tearing and discharge from the eyes. Another common cause is eye infections, such as conjunctivitis, which can cause a thick, yellow discharge to build up in the corners of the eyes. Other potential causes include blocked tear ducts, foreign objects in the eye, or underlying health issues such as respiratory infections or feline herpesvirus.

Symptoms of Cats Eye Gunk

It’s important to be able to recognize the symptoms of eye gunk in your cat so that you can take appropriate action. Some common symptoms include redness or swelling around the eyes, excessive tearing, squinting or blinking, pawing at the eyes, and discharge that ranges from clear and watery to thick and yellow or green in color. If you notice any of these symptoms in your cat, it’s a good idea to consult with your veterinarian for a proper diagnosis and treatment plan.

Treating Cats Eye Gunk

The treatment for your cat’s eye gunk will depend on the underlying cause. For mild cases, you may be able to gently clean the discharge from your cat’s eyes using a damp cloth or sterile saline solution. However, if the eye gunk persists or is accompanied by other symptoms, such as swelling or redness, it’s best to seek veterinary care. Your vet may prescribe antibiotics, antiviral medications, or other treatments to help clear up the issue and prevent it from recurring.

Preventing Cats Eye Gunk

While it may not be possible to prevent all cases of eye gunk in cats, there are some steps you can take to help reduce the risk. Keeping your cat’s eyes clean by gently wiping away any discharge with a damp cloth can help prevent buildup. Additionally, regular veterinary check-ups can help catch any underlying health issues early on, before they develop into more serious problems. Providing a healthy diet and keeping your cat’s environment clean and stress-free can also contribute to overall eye health and reduce the likelihood of eye gunk developing.
